Essential Files for UK Player Verification
Casinos licensed in the UK require specific papers to authenticate three elements: your person, your residence, and that the payment method belongs to you. The papers must be up-to-date, legible, and untouched. Photos or scans are fine, but all text must be readable. An outdated passport or licence will not be accepted. Here is the usual collection of documents you’ll likely need.
- ID Verification: A photographic identification from the state. The majority opt for a acceptable UK Driving Licence (full or provisional) or a Passport. For non-UK citizens, a identity card from the EEA might be accepted, given that it has your picture and birth date.
- Address Proof: A up-to-date document, issued within three months, indicating your full name and your registered address. Typical examples are a utility bill for electricity, gas, or water; a financial statement; a credit card statement; a Council Tax bill; or an government-issued letter. Occasionally a driving licence with your address may serve as both ID and address proof, if the casino allows it.
- Payment Method Verification: This proves the account or card you utilize for deposits is yours. With a debit card, you could be required to provide a snapshot of the obverse (with the eight middle digits hidden for safety) and the rear (showing the signature panel). For e-wallets like PayPal or Skrill, a screen capture of your account overview page is generally adequate.

Typical Reasons for KYC Delays and Rejections
Stops on verification are irritating, but the explanations are usually simple. The greatest problem is low document quality. A fuzzy photo, a trimmed corner, or a reflection hiding important details will result in you have to upload it again. Another frequent snag is a inconsistency. The full name and residence on your ID must align with the information on your casino account precisely. A absent middle initial or a varying spelling can lead to trouble.
Sending an unacceptable document will lead to rejection. A hand-written note or a hard copy of an online bill without a valid letterhead won’t work. Also, if you attempt to verify while connected to a VPN or proxy service that hides your UK location, the compliance team will flag it. The secret is to provide documents that are current, absolutely clear, and compatible with your account details.
User Protections and Information Safety Under UKGC Regulations
If you wager in the UK, you have strong protections under data security and privacy rules. The UK Gambling Commission enforces these. Casinos must handle your personal information with top-level security, using encryption and protected servers. Your documents are solely for verification and preventing fraud. Operators cannot share them for marketing unless you explicitly agree.
You have the right to see how your data is held and used. This will be specified in the casino’s Privacy Policy. If you believe an operator is mismanaging your information or applying KYC rules improperly, you can file a complaint to the UKGC. This oversight means the verification process, while compulsory, must also uphold your rights as a customer.

Paperwork and Technical Difficulties
Players often wonder about what documents they can use and how to fix upload problems.
What if I don’t have a utility bill in my name?
You possess other options the UKGC recognizes. A recent bank statement or building society statement, either a printed copy or a PDF, works perfectly. A current UK driving licence (if you haven’t used it for ID), a Council Tax bill for this year, or a letter from HMRC or the DWP are also valid. If you stay with someone else, a few operators might approve a document in their name plus a signed letter from them verifying your address, but this isn’t common practice.

How should I proceed if my verification is taking longer than expected?
Commence by checking your email spam folder and the message inbox in your casino account. The team might have asked for more details. If you see nothing, get in touch with the casino’s customer support. Use live chat or email. Hold your username handy and inquire politely for an update on your verification. Avoid uploading the same documents over and over, as that can hinder things down even more.
